Redundancypay is owed when an employee has been made redundant because their job is not required by business anymore due to changes or bankruptcy. Redundancy pay is a form of severance pay. ReemploymentDuring Severance Pay Period. If employees are reemployed at Brandeis in any capacity during the severance pay period, severance pay ceases upon the effective date of the change.
